Cuddle lovely pets and enjoy free accommodation on your Coffs Harbour house sitting adventure. You can enjoy the scenic view or grab a bite with your new furry friend. The panoramic views from the Forest Sky Pier also make the city worth visiting.
If you’re looking after a dog at Coffs Harbour and you’re feeling peckish, head to Moonee Beach with your furry friends to grab a bite to eat. Just north of Coff’s Harbour, you’ll find Maggie’s Dog Cafe, which is one of the most pet-friendly eateries in the area. There’s even a doggie play area and menu with treats like pies and peanut butter, in addition to drinks and tasty dishes for humans. This dog-friendly cafe even has grooming services and dog parties!
When taking care of a dog in Coffs Harbour, make sure to catch some sun on the various beaches. Though dogs are prohibited on most beaches, North Wall Beach is an off-leash beach. Spend the day with your furry friends and play on the sand or go for a swim in the cool waters. You can combine your beach adventure with a visit to the historic Coffs Harbour Jetty, dating back to 1892. Pets can tag along on a leash while you explore the local area and marvel at the beautiful landscape.
If you are looking for an off-leash outdoor area for your furry friends to let loose, head to Thompsons Road Reserve on the southern side of the harbour. It is the perfect spot for afternoon relaxing during your Coffs Harbour house sitting trip. The park is fully enclosed, and pets can run around and socialise with other animals. The trees around the park provide adequate shade from the sun, and you can rest in the sitting areas as you watch your companions play. The creek is open for dogs, and they can swim or play in the freshwater.
Are you house sitting in Coffs Harbour? Spend time exploring the beautiful rainforests or walking along the stunning trails. Most rainforests are off-limits for pets, but the Orara East State Forest is a dog-friendly exception. You can hike the hills or walk through the banana plantations to get to Sealy Lookout and the Forest Sky Pier. The viewing platform is raised, so you can get a clear view of popular attractions, like Marina and Big Banana. Pets are welcome on the platform, provided they are brave and not scared of heights. Just be sure to keep them on a leash - safety first! You can spend the day around the pier or have a snack in the picnic areas.
